Weber Canyon, UT: U. P. Railroad in Weber CanyonThis vintage linen postcard of Weber Canyon, Utah was printed by the Tichnor Brothers of Boston, circa 19301945. It pictures U. P. Railroad in Weber Canyon, Utah. It survives as a small, vivid window into Weber Canyon as travelers once saw it. It comes from the golden age of American "linen" postcards , named for the soft, textured rag paper that gave them their warmth and glow , and belongs to the celebrated Tichnor Brothers Collection.
